Last weekend I was with a group of Nigerians for their annual retreat. It was a very exciting time for them since two of the top leaders of their denomination in Nigeria came to be with them.

One of the leaders said several times over, that in the first 14 years of missionaries coming to Nigeria, starting 130 years ago, there were more missionary graves than converts. But today in Nigeria alone that denomination has 8,000 churches and 10 million members! (this large group of churches is just one "branch" that grew out of SIM, the organization Phil Bauman is serving)

They are so grateful to Canadians because it was from Toronto that those missionaries first went. It's something for us to be greatly encouraged about!
